Book excerpt: The purpose of this project was to compare the accuracy and precision of linear measurements made on conventional lateral cephalograms (LC) and simulated LC using cone-beam computed tomography (CBCT) to direct measurements on dentate skulls. The linear distances for 5 mid-sagittal and 4 bilateral measurements between anatomical landmarks on 22 skulls were measured by two observers. The skulls were imaged using a CBCT scanner at 4 scan settings: high resolution (0.2mm) and normal resolution (0.4mm) at 20-sec (306 projections) and 40-sec scans (612 projections). Three simulated LC were generated: Ray sum image reconstructions of the maximum thickness mid-sagittal multiplanar projections, a single frame basis projection, and the scout image. LCs were acquired using a storage phosphor system. Projection images were exported into a cephalometric analysis program and linear measurements determined. Analyses were repeated three times and statistically compared to measured anatomic truth using repeated measures general linear model (p [less than or equal to] 0.05). The mean absolute error was used as an index of precision. While there were statistical differences between skull and modality measurements for 6 of the nine measurements, there were no overall differences between LC and CBCT derived image measurements irrespective of method of construction. CBCT imaging provides clinically reliable 2D simulation images however, dose considerations demand that evidence-based selection criteria should be developed for CBCT in orthodontics that take into account the ALARA principle.

Book excerpt: The purpose of this project was to compare the accuracy and reliability of linear measurements made on 2D projections and 3D reconstructions using Dolphin 3D software (Chatsworth, CA) as compared to direct measurements made on human skulls. The linear dimensions between 6 bilateral and 8 mid-sagittal anatomical landmarks on 23 dentate dry human skulls were measured three times by multiple observers using a digital caliper to provide twenty orthodontic linear measurements. The skulls were stabilized and imaged via PSP digital cephalometry as well as CBCT. The PSP cephalograms were imported into Dolphin (Chatsworth, CA, USA) and the 3D volumetric data set was imported into Dolphin 3D (Version 2.3, Chatsworth, CA, USA).Using Dolphin 3D, planar cephalograms as well as 3D volumetric surface reconstructions were (3D CBCT) generated. The linear measurements between landmarks of each three modalities were then computed by a single observer three times. For 2D measurements, a one way ANOVA for each measurement dimension was calculated as well as a post hoc Scheffe multiple comparison test with the anatomic distance as the control group. 3D measurements were compared to anatomic truth using Student's t test (P [less than or equal to] 50.05). The intraclass correlation coefficient (ICC) and absolute linear and percentage error were determined as indices of intraobserver reliability. Our results show that for 2D mid sagittal measurements that Simulated LC images are accurate and similar to those from PSP images (except for Ba-Na), and for bilateral measurements simulated LC measurements were similar to PSP but less accurate, underestimating dimensions by between 4.7% to 17%.For 3D volumetric renderings, 2/3 rd of CBCT measurements are statistically different from actual measurements, however this possibly is not clinically relevant.

To compare the in vitro reliability and accuracy of linear measurements between cephalometric landmarks on CBCT 3D images with varying basis projection images to direct measurements on human skulls. Methods. Sixteen linear dimensions between anatomical sites marked on 19 human skulls were directly measured. Skulls were imaged with CBCT at three settings: 153, 306, and 612 basis projections. The mean absolute error and modality mean of linear measurements between landmarks on 3D images were compared to the anatomic truth. Results. No difference in mean absolute error between the scan settings was found. The average skull absolute error between marked reference points were less than the distances between unmarked reference sites. Conclusion. CBCT measurements were consistent between scan sequences and for direct measurements between marked reference points. Reducing the number of projections for 3D reconstruction did not lead to reduced dimensional accuracy and potentially provides reduced patient radiation exposure.

Book excerpt: Cone beam CT imaging provides highly accurate, multi-planar and 3D imaging and is changing the way dentists visualize, diagnose and treat the dental patient. This book provides CBCT users, irrespective of system, with technical details on image acquisition. It also offers image protocols and an evidence-based approach to the use of this modality in the context of general and specialty applications. In addition, the book outlines and illustrates specific CBCT diagnostic imaging features with a systems approach for use in interpreting images. It also describes in detail existing and newly developed treatment-guided options afforded by CBCT technology.

Book excerpt: Examination of corals and reef-associated organisms which endure in extreme coral reef environments is challenging our understanding of the conditions that organisms can survive under. By studying individuals naturally adapted to unfavorable conditions, we begin to better understand the important traits required to survive rapid environmental and climate change. This Research Topic, comprising reviews, and original research articles, demonstrates the current state of knowledge regarding the diversity of extreme coral habitats, the species that have been studied, and the knowledge to-date on the mechanisms, traits and trade-offs that have facilitated survival.

Book excerpt: The problems related to the process of industrialisation such as biodiversity depletion, climate change and a worsening of health and living conditions, especially but not only in developing countries, intensify. Therefore, there is an increasing need to search for integrated solutions to make development more sustainable. The United Nations has acknowledged the problem and approved the “2030 Agenda for Sustainable Development”. On 1st January 2016, the 17 Sustainable Development Goals (SDGs) of the Agenda officially came into force. These goals cover the three dimensions of sustainable development: economic growth, social inclusion and environmental protection. The Encyclopedia of the UN Sustainable Development Goals comprehensively addresses the SDGs in an integrated way. It encompasses 17 volumes, each one devoted to one of the 17 SDGs. This volume is dedicated to SDG 14 “Conserve and sustainably use the oceans, seas and marine resources for sustainable development". Marine and coastal bio-resources, play an essential role in human well-being and social and economic development. This volume addresses this sustainability challenge providing the description of a range of terms, which allows a better understanding and fosters knowledge about it.
